fattening up nicely,soon be big enough for pics again,lol.After i took em out of brumation they never started eating till about 2 weeks later,that and the fact they were under for a month and a half meant they were a little on the slim side
Getting there now though,plenty waxworms and mealies!Hey i got a Q,nothing real important or that but my gang go through spates of eating only the black crickets then changing to mealies then brown crickets in no particular order,waxworms are always eaten with enthusiasm.My Q is does anyone elses collareds do this,just curious and trying to strike a convo as well i suppose

Well I have some who prefer nothing but crickets, some who love both crickets and superworms, and some who just LOVE superworms.
So guess my answer would have to be they have their own preferences, or tastes, like we do.
Chia, the female vestiguim, loves spiders and those big flying ant things.

or so he keeps saying anyway!I would tend to disagree there but ill leave that for santa to decide.As for spiders,hell all my collareds go nutz for them but ive never tried the flying antz (future queens i believe)as we only get them for about 1 week of the year
Now moths,theres a food item to give owners a load of fun,dont know about anyone else but i think watching the collareds leap 2 feet in the air to catch a moth is amazing,i could watch em do it all day!Ive alot of native insects here and with varying degrees of success,one that they couldnt care less for was wood lice,which is a shame because there is a bung of these all year round but then again theres not much to em either.I may get flamed for this one but ive also tried the small centipedes which the collareds somehow recognised as venomous as instead of just pouncing on em,they sorta bit them and threw them around a bit until they were lifeless then ate them.They do the same with the larger female wolf spiders,but with alot more vigour
